[Code of Federal Regulations] [Title 17, Volume 1] [Revised as of April 1, 2007] From the U.S. Government Printing Office via GPO Access [CITE: 17CFR10.93] [Page 255] TITLE 17--COMMODITY AND SECURITIES EXCHANGES CHAPTER I--COMMODITY FUTURES TRADING COMMISSION PART 10_RULES OF PRACTICE--Table of Contents Subpart G_Disposition Without Full Hearing Sec. 10.93 Obtaining default order. When a respondent has failed to (a) file an answer as provided in Sec. 10.23 of these rules or (b) failed to appear or file a notice of appearance as provided in Sec. 10.62 of these rules or (c) failed to file a statement under the shortened procedures as provided in Sec. 10.92 of these rules, the Division of Enforcement may move the Administrative Law Judge to enter findings and conclusions and a default order against that respondent based upon the matters set forth in the complaint, which shall be deemed to be true for purposes of this determination.
